【摘要】:Sincetheanalysisoftheatmosphereisinfluencedbyphenomenainwhichallfactorsexceptthemethodofsamplingandanalyticalprocedurearebeyondthecontroloftheinvestigator,statisticalconsiderationmustbegiventodeterminetheadequacyofthenumberofsamplesobtained,thelengthoftimethatthesamplingprogramiscarriedout,andthenumberofsitessampled.Thepurposeofthesamplingandthecharacteristicsofthecontaminanttobemeasuredwillhaveaninfluenceindeterminingthisadequacy.Regular,orifpossible,continuousmeasurementsofthecontaminantwithsimultaneouspertinentmeteorologicalobservationsshouldbeobtainedduringallseasonsoftheyear.Statisticaltechniquesmaythenbeappliedtodeterminetheinfluenceofthemeteorologicalvariablesontheconcentrationsmeasured(2).Statisticalmethodsmaybeusedfortheinterpretationofallofthedataavailable(2).Trendsofpatternsandrelationshipsbetweenvariablesofstatisticalsignificancemaybedetected.Muchofthevalidityoftheresultswilldepend,however,onthecomprehensivenessoftheanalysisandthelocationandcontaminantmeasured.Forexample,if24-hsamplesofsuspendedparticulatematterareobtainedonlyperiodically(forexample,every6or8daysthroughouttheyear),thegeometricmeanofthemeasuredconcentrationsisrepresentativeofthemedianvalueassumingthedataarelognormallydistributed.Thegeometricmeanlevelmaybeusedtocomparetheairqualityatdifferentlocationsatwhichsuchregularbutintermittentobservationsofsuspendedparticulatematteraremade.1.1Thepurposeofthispracticeistopresentthebroadconceptsofsamplingtheambientairfortheconcentrationsofcontaminants.Detailedproceduresarenotdiscussed.Generalprinciplesinplanningasamplingprogramaregivenincludingguidelinesfortheselectionofsitesandthelocationoftheairsamplinginlet.1.2Investigationsofatmosphericcontaminantsinvolvethestudyofaheterogeneousmassunderuncontrolledconditions.Interpretationofthedataderivedfromtheairsamplingprogrammustoftenbebasedonthestatisticaltheoryofprobability.Extremecaremustbeobservedtoobtainmeasurementsoverasufficientlengthoftimetoobtainresultsthatmaybeconsideredrepresentative.1.3Thevariablesthatmayaffectthecontaminantconcentrationsaretheatmosphericstability(temperature-heightprofile),turbulence,windspeedanddirection,solarradiation,precipitation,topography,emissionrates,chemicalreactionratesfortheirformationanddecomposition,andthephysicalandchemicalpropertiesofthecontaminant.Toobtainconcentrationsofgaseouscontaminantsintermsofweightperunitvolume,theambienttemperatureandatmosphericpressureatthelocationsampledmustbeknown.1.4Thisstandarddoesnotpurporttoaddressallofthesafetyconcerns,ifany,associatedwithitsuse.Itistheresponsibilityoftheuserofthisstandardtoestablishappropriatesafetyandhealthpracticesanddeterminetheapplicabilityofregulatorylimitationspriortouse.
